Signature Global: Can its new JV with RMZ group mark entry into ₹16,000 Cr commercial project?

Synopsis: Signature Global’s 50% stake dilution in Gurugram Commercity Limited marks a strategic shift into commercial real estate. The Rs 1,293 crore JV with RMZ enables capital-efficient entry into a Rs 14,000–16,000 crore mixed-use project, allowing risk sharing, asset monetisation, and diversification beyond its traditional residential-focused business model.

The company has made a strategic move by venturing into the commercial real estate space through a joint venture with RMZ. By diluting the holding of its subsidiary by 50%, the company has gained access to a large mixed-use development opportunity in Gurugram. The company has made a significant move in the direction of diversification, efficiency, and participation in high-value assets.

Signatureglobal Limited is a real estate development company operating in the National Capital Region of Delhi, focused on offering affordable and mid-segment housing. With a market cap of Rs 10,035 crore, the shares of the company are trading at Rs 714 and are trading at a PE of 3,000 compared to their industry’s PE of 23. The shares have given a return of more than 45% since their listing in September 2023.

Stake dilution drives entry

The push to dilute a 50% stake in its subsidiary company, Gurugram Commercity Limited, marks a significant change in the company’s business strategy. By partnering with RMZ Group, an equal partner, the company has managed to monetise a part of its asset and still maintain a strong grip on its business.

The Rs 1,293 crore investment will not only provide immediate financial benefits to the company, allowing it to undertake large-scale developments without over-leveraging its balance sheet, but also mark a significant change in its business strategy.

The more important aspect of this deal is that a wholly owned subsidiary company has been converted to a 50:50 joint venture, allowing a company to share risks on a capital-intensive project such as a commercial project. This is particularly important for a company that has traditionally focused on housing developments.

This deal also marks a significant change in the company’s business strategy, as it is no longer a company focused on affordable and mid-income housing alone. The company is looking to expand its business to premium and commercial real estate, a trend seen in the changing urbanisation patterns of people.

JV unlocks Rs 16,000 crore project

This JV creates the platform for the development of a large-scale mixed-use commercial project located on the Southern Peripheral Road in Gurugram, which is one of the fastest-growing real estate markets. The project is spread over nearly 3.94 million sq. ft. and will feature office space, retail, and hospitality.

This project is one of the largest commercial real estate bets in the region, with an estimated total capital value of Rs 14,000–16,000 crore. Signature Global is now poised to develop high-value, annuity-generating commercial real estate projects, as opposed to its traditional model of one-time sales of residential properties.

This JV is also significant because it is Signature Global’s first large-scale commercial project on its existing land bank. It is, therefore, a milestone in the company’s growth journey. Signature Global is demonstrating its intent to develop a diversified real estate portfolio.

In essence, the JV is not merely a simple stake sale transaction. It is a strategic shift for Signature Global to enter the commercial real estate space with a high-value model. It is a partnership-driven model with the right risk-adjusted capital efficiency.
